Doors to fire safety
Fire safety doors are among the most important safety features you can have put in your building. They prevent the spread of fire and smoke and help safeguard lives and properties. The proper door can save thousands of dollars in losses and damage. Property owners should think about this easy and inexpensive investment.
Like any other piece of equipment, a fire-safety door needs to be regularly inspected. This is particularly important for doors that are often used. In general, it is recommended that a fire door be inspected at a minimum of every six months.
If you are installing a new fire door, be sure to follow the manufacturer's guidelines. Look at the label to determine the correct fire rating and make sure that it meets all the required safety standards.
It is also recommended to inspect the intumescent seals that are on your fire door. Replace them if they are damaged. An intumescent seal is a special material that expands when exposed to heat. These seals block smoke from getting into the doorway and fill in the gaps between the frame and the door.
You should also inspect the glazing. It should be free of cracks. Additional requirements could be imposed by your local fire code. To check the gap between the floor and the door, a gap gauge is highly recommended.
A gap between 10mm and 3mm should suffice for a non-smokedoor. Depending on the location, a greater gap might be required.
Fire-rated doors should be tested according European standards, like BS EN1634-2. A door may also be certified using the BWF Fire Alliance Door Scheme.
If you're a landlord, property owner or business owner you have a legal responsibility to ensure that your premises are safe. To avoid a disaster ensure that your fire safety doors are checked.
